If the 150RMB ticket price for 'Rain Room' been putting you off from seeing it, there's now a special pass that will save you a pint while throwing on some more value. The Art 24 Hours pass will run you 118RMB for an early bird ticket, and starting this coming Saturday 26 May, it'll get you entry into over 40 participating Shanghai art galleries and museums for 24 hours.


The only way to buy a pass is by extracting the circle-QR code below. It's all in Chinese, but fairly simple if you just tap the red button in the bottom right of your screen, enter your phone number towards the bottom of the next page, and then pay with WeChat.


You can find a list of some participating institutions here (in Chinese), or follow 'Art_24Hours' on WeChat for more info. Their account is mainly in Chinese, though it's not too difficult to go through the pictures and pick out gallery addresses below them.


Once the early bird sale is over, the pass will be sold for the discounted price of 138RMB for a limited time. The full price for the pass is going to be 158RMB. Even at full price, the pass is a pretty good deal, especially if you're a two-or-more-exhibitions-in-one-day kind of person.


So now you can spend a couple hours at 'Rain Room' in Yuz Museum, then take a wander to the cluster of galleries a bit further down West Bund, or go further up to Power Station of Art and into Jingan's villa-gone-art venue Prada Rong Zhai – all on one well-priced ticket. Art is a blast.
